How Does CareLuminate Estimate The Nurse Recommendation Score?

With over 1,000 nurses having participated with CareLuminate to date, we have found that the relationship between hospital patient recommendation ratings and nurse recommendation ratings is very strong (p<.001, R-squared = .42). 

While the two ratings are often similar, the comments from nurses are extremely important because they show an important 'inside view' into strengths or concerns in a hospital. CareLuminate is working towards offering nurse insights into every hospital in the US.

Summary of Hospital-Reported Data

The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services requires hospitals to collect and report on hospital quality and patient satisfaction data. While the data can be dated (collected 1 to 4 years ago) the insights are an important view into hospital safety and quality. We looked through all of this data, and here is our summary of what we found:

Redington Fairview General Hospital receives high overall patient satisfaction ratings, indicating a positive experience for those who receive care there. Patients especially appreciate the hospital's cleanliness, emphasizing the favorable environment provided. Additionally, Redington Fairview General Hospital demonstrates average mortality rates across all measured aspects, indicating that the hospital has a standard level of efficacy in terms of patient outcomes. The hospital also maintains an average emergency room wait time, where patients are typically seen and treated within 2-3 hours.
